DEI ban ‘doesn’t do anything’: Undercover video raises legal questions about UT Austin

The University of Texas at Austin says it has “fully implemented” the state’s diversity, equity, and inclusion ban in response to a recent undercover video that showed a gender studies employee saying the law “doesn’t do anything yet other than create more work.”

But Accuracy in Media President Adam Guillette told The College Fix that the law itself is part of the problem. His organization investigates universities in conservative led states “to find out if they’re following the law.”

“The Texas DEI ban isn’t worth the paper it’s printed on,” Guillette said in a recent interview. “DEI staffers have simply changed job titles and DEI is still being promoted in the curriculum.”

However, Guillette also said AIM does not believe Texas universities are fully complying with the state’s restrictions.

“Multiple administrators have lost their jobs after appearing in our videos,” he said. “It’s clear that these universities think they’re above the law.”
